What is Herbal Medicine?
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M) utilizes over 500 commonly used substances categorized primarily by their natural origins: plant/botanical materials (roots, flowers, bark), minerals, and animal products. These are then dispensed and consumed in various delivery forms, such as raw dried herbs, prepared powders, or topical pastes.
Herbal medicine offers a holistic approach to wellness by using plant extracts to support the body's natural healing systems. Key benefits include reduced inflammation, improved digestion, better immune function, and stress management. Because many herbs address underlying imbalances rather than just symptoms, they are often used for long-term health and preventive care.
